Public Health

Public Health

 
Are you someone who likes the big picture? If so, you may want to consider the role of a PharmD in public health. The PharmD curriculum will make you uniquely qualified to have a role in policy formulation on issues as diverse as health literacy, immunizations, substance abuse, medication disposal and syringe disposal. This can translate to broad public health initiatives including the identification of community health problems and cooperating with existing community support services. This often involves the establishment of health priorities, policy development, and the management and assessment of those programs to which the PharmD brings unique and valuable insight.
 
The public health pharmacist will take an active role in organizing other pharmacists in activities like public education about prevalent diseases such as hypertension, diabetes, and cancer. You will also have opportunities in the public and private sector to design outreach programs focused on wellness and disease prevention.
 
By improving the system by which healthcare is dispensed, the PharmD involved in public health initiatives will have a rewarding professional experience.
